Spring consistently offers some of the strongest conditions for home sellers, but according to Realtor.com, there’s one specific week when everything aligns perfectly—and it’s fast approaching.

Based on historical data, the prime week to list your home this year is April 12–18.

Here’s why this window is particularly advantageous for sellers:

Buyers Are More Engaged. Homes listed during this week typically receive 16.7% more views than usual, giving your property extra exposure in a competitive market.

Faster Sales. Increased buyer activity can also speed up the selling process. Properties listed during this week spent 17% less time on the market compared to other times, helping you close sooner.

Higher Chances of Full Price. With fewer homes needing price reductions, about 18.9% fewer listings drop their price during this window, boosting your odds of selling at your asking price.

More Profit. Well-prepared homes listed in this period can sell for roughly $5,300 more than the average week, and even $26,000 more than listings from the start of the year.

In short, listing in mid-April can mean more attention, faster offers, and a better price—exactly what every seller wants.
